Perfect Square
34735580155617682735341161449 is a perfect square (186374837774893 × 186374837774893)
34735580155617682735341161449 is a perfect square (186374837774893 × 186374837774893)
34735580155617682735341161449 is odd
Previous odd number is 34735580155617682735341161447
Next odd number is 34735580155617682735341161451
11100000011110010011001001101010101110011111110001011001001011110100010111100101100101111101001
41910579958907715279207180901765404832096492218442911826492801172458271674030873801849